lynxpoint: fix enable_pm1() function

The new enable_pm1() function was doing 2 things wrong:

1. It was doing a RMW of the pm1 register. This means we were
   keeping around the enables from the OS during S3 resume. This
   is bad in the face of the RTC alarm waking us up because it would
   cause an infinite stream of SMIs.
2. The register size of PM1_EN is 16-bits. However, the previous
   implementation was accessing it as a 32-bit register.

The PM1 enables should only be set to what we expect to handle in the
firmware before the OS changes to ACPI mode.
